Because of to the mind-boggling response from trustworthy shoppers, Yoder’s delivered an rationalization for its final decision to shut down.
Mrs. Yoder’s Kitchen was previously owned by Judy and Jay Yoder who started off the truck-based mostly organization in 2011. In 2016, they relocated to Pennsylvania to treatment for a spouse and children member.
The present house owners Lucas Miller of Brunswick and his brother-in-law Samuel Amaya of Dinwiddie purchased the small business in April of 2017 after returning to this space from a church mission in Nicaragua.
Aspect of the Mennonite community, the Miller and Amaya families have operated and expanded Yoder’s ever considering that.

“Now, we have been named to provide at the time all over again in Nicaragua underneath the mission team Christian Assist Ministries, primarily based out of Berlin, Ohio,” Yoder’s assertion said.
Leaving in June, The Miller relatives options to be directors for a Pastors Discipleship Center in the outskirts of Nicaragua’s cash Managua, and the Amaya household ideas to depart in Could to be directors of a clinic in northern Nicaragua.
In October of 2021, Yoder’s commenced wanting for anyone with a passion to continue on generating their delicious treats. They discovered a family members that was fascinated in getting the small business to go on the custom.
“It has been a prolonged method to consider and get this switched over, and now, because of to some conflict in their family members, they have returned the enterprise again to us,” Yoder’s statement reported. “We are in the method of choosing what our up coming stage should really be.”
In 2021, Mrs. Yoder’s Kitchen area was showcased in the “Meals and Wine” magazine for building the ideal donuts in the entire state of Virginia.
As the Miller and Amaya people research for anyone to carry on Yoder’s legacy, they are inquiring faithful patrons to be client and to enjoy for updates.
